4015
Blend of Barrel-Aged Ales
13.8% ABV
4015 is our 13.8% blend of Barrel-Aged Ales that was created to commemorate our 11th Anniversary. Since our First Anniversary release, 365, we have reserved a portion of each year’s release so it can be blended the following year to create the next Anniversary Ale. By doing each one of our Anniversary releases contains a piece of our brewing past. 4015 combines small pieces of the last decade of our barrel-aging program with all the complexities of our current barrel stock.

8th Anniversary Port Redux
Blend of Barrel-Aged Ales
12.4% ABV
Inspired by our first anniversary ale, Port Anniversary Redux was created by separately double barrel-aging our rye barrel-aged anniversary blend and one of our imperial stouts in both Ruby and Tawny Port wine barrels. After aging for 10 months, we separately racked the components of each beer into stainless for conditioning. Once ready, we blended the components to taste, then aged the blend on Ghanaian cacao nibs to achieve a flavor profile similar to a dessert wine and chocolate pairing.

Triple Barrel Aged 2920
Blend of Barrel-Aged Ales
14.4% ABV
Triple Barrel-Aged 2920 is our 14.4% Triple Barrel-Aged variant of our Eighth Anniversary Ale. Following the release of our 8th Anniversary Ale, 2920, we took a portion of that barrel-aged blend and racked it into a single Cognac puncheon. After considerable time in that puncheon, we spilt the blend into a single Rum Barrel and Amburana cask. After finishing in those barrels we blend the two together and cold conditioned in stainless before packaging.
